Choosing Your Portal to Virtual Worlds: A VR Headset Buying Guide

Virtual Reality (VR) headsets let you jump right into video games. They surround your eyes with digital worlds. Picking the right one can be tricky. This guide helps you find the best gaming VR headset for you.

Key Features to Look For

When shopping for a gaming VR headset, certain features matter most. These features decide how good your game experience will be.

Resolution and Field of View (FOV)

  • Resolution: This is how clear the picture looks. Higher resolution means sharper images and less of the “screen door” effect (where you see tiny dots). Look for headsets with at least 1832 x 1920 pixels per eye for good clarity.
  • Field of View (FOV): This measures how much of the virtual world you can see at once. A wider FOV (like 110 degrees or more) makes the experience feel more natural and less like looking through binoculars.

Tracking System

Tracking tells the headset where your head and hands are in the real room. There are two main types:

  • Inside-Out Tracking: Cameras are built into the headset itself. This is easy to set up. You don’t need extra sensors around your room.
  • Outside-In Tracking: This uses external sensors or base stations placed in your room. It often offers more precise tracking, which is great for fast-paced games.

Refresh Rate

The refresh rate (measured in Hertz, Hz) is how many times the screen updates per second. A higher refresh rate (90Hz or 120Hz) makes motion look smoother. This significantly reduces motion sickness.

Important Materials and Comfort

You wear the headset for hours, so comfort is vital. The materials used affect how heavy and breathable the device feels.

Headset Construction

  • Weight Distribution: A good headset balances its weight well. Heavy fronts cause neck strain. Look for adjustable straps that spread the weight evenly.
  • Facial Interface: This is the foam or padding that touches your face. Soft, breathable materials like PU leather or cloth are best. They stop too much sweat buildup.

Lenses

Lenses focus the screen image for your eyes. Fresnel lenses are common, but newer Pancake lenses make headsets lighter and clearer, though they can sometimes cost more.

Factors That Improve or Reduce Quality

What makes one headset better than another? It often comes down to the technology inside and how well it works with your computer.

Processing Power (PC vs. Standalone)

  • PC VR Headsets: These plug into a powerful gaming computer. They offer the highest graphics quality and complex games. If you own a strong PC, this boosts your quality.
  • Standalone VR Headsets: These have the computer built right in. They are portable and easy to use. Their graphics are usually simpler than PC VR, but they are much more convenient.

IPD Adjustment

IPD stands for Interpupillary Distance—the space between your pupils. If the headset lenses don’t match your IPD, the image looks blurry or causes eye strain. Always choose a headset that lets you adjust the IPD easily.

User Experience and Use Cases

Think about what you want to do with the headset. This helps narrow down your choice.

Gaming Types

  • Room-Scale Gaming: You need lots of space and excellent tracking for games where you physically walk around.
  • Seated Experiences: Flight simulators or cockpit games do not need much movement. A lighter, less complex headset often works fine here.
  • Fitness Games: For active games, a headset that handles sweat well and stays securely attached during movement is necessary.

Setup Difficulty

Some systems require complex sensor placement (setup is harder). Others work right out of the box (setup is simple). Beginners usually prefer the simpler, inside-out tracking systems.


10 Frequently Asked Questions (FAQ) About Gaming VR Headsets

Q: Do I need a super powerful gaming PC for all VR headsets?

A: No. Standalone headsets run games using their own built-in chips. PC-tethered headsets, however, need a strong graphics card and processor for the best performance.

Q: What is “screen door effect”?

A: This happens when you can see the tiny gaps between the pixels on the screen. Better resolution headsets mostly fix this problem.

Q: Can I wear my glasses inside a VR headset?

A: Most modern headsets have enough space for standard glasses. Some even sell special prescription lens inserts you can snap in place.

Q: How long can I safely play VR at one time?

A: It varies by person. Many people feel comfortable playing for 30 to 60 minutes before needing a short break. Listen to your body to avoid dizziness.

Q: What is “latency” in VR?

A: Latency is the delay between when you move your head and when the screen updates. Low latency is crucial; high latency causes motion sickness.

Q: Are VR games cheaper than standard console games?

A: Prices are similar, but sales happen often. Standalone games are sometimes cheaper because they run on less powerful hardware.

Q: What is the minimum room size needed for good VR gaming?

A: For the best room-scale games, a clear space of 6.5 feet by 6.5 feet is often recommended. Smaller spaces work for seated games.

Q: Why is the refresh rate important for motion sickness?

A: A high refresh rate keeps the visuals smooth, matching what your inner ear expects from movement. Low refresh rates cause a mismatch, leading to nausea.

Q: Do I need to buy special controllers?

A: Yes. Most VR systems come with dedicated motion controllers that track your hand movements. These are essential for interacting with the virtual world.

Q: How is wireless VR better than wired VR?

A: Wireless VR gives you total freedom of movement without tripping over cables. Wired VR often provides the absolute best visual quality because data moves faster through the cable.
